This patch moves the path selection logic from individual
programs to a new diffcore transformer (diff-tree still needs
to have its own for performance reasons). Also the header
printing code in diff-tree was tweaked not to produce anything
when pickaxe is in effect and there is nothing interesting to
report. An interesting example is the following in the GIT
archive itself:
$ git-whatchanged -p -C -S'or something in a real script'
